Design and Aesthetics
The 2024 Hyundai Santa Fe Calligraphy boasts a bold and sophisticated design that sets it apart from its competitors. The exterior features a boxy, rugged appearance with a long wheelbase and large windows, reminiscent of Land Rover styling. The high hood and upright grille contribute to its commanding presence on the road.

Interior Design and Comfort
Stepping inside the 2024 Santa Fe Calligraphy reveals a significantly updated interior compared to the previous version. The curved panoramic screen seamlessly incorporates the infotainment touchscreen display and digital gauge cluster, creating a modern and intuitive cockpit.
The front seats are a highlight of the Calligraphy trim, featuring premium Nappa leather upholstery, ample padding, and excellent bolstering for both comfort and support. Second-row passengers can enjoy the luxury of captain's chairs, enhancing the overall seating experience.
Seating Dimensions | Front | Rear |
---|---|---|
Head Room | 40.2 in. | 39.6 in. |
Leg Room | 44.4 in. | 42.3 in. |
Shoulder Room | 59.5 in. | 58.1 in. |
Hip Room | 56.5 in. | 54.9 in. |
The Santa Fe Calligraphy offers a choice of Black or Beige interior color schemes, both exuding a sense of elegance and refinement.

Performance and Powertrain
The 2024 Hyundai Santa Fe Calligraphy is powered by a robust 2.5-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ine, delivering an impressive 277 horsepower and 311 lb-ft of torque. This engine is paired with an eight-speed dual-clutch transmission (DCT), ensuring quick and smooth power delivery for an engaging driving experience.
I found the Santa Fe Calligraphy's performance to be more than adequate for everyday driving and highway passing maneuvers. The turbocharged engine provides ample power, making the SUV feel competitive in its segment. The DCT shifts seamlessly, contributing to the overall refined driving experience.
Fuel efficiency is another highlight of the 2024 Santa Fe Calligraphy. With front-wheel drive (FWD), the SUV achieves an EPA-estimated 20 mpg in the city, 29 mpg on the highway, and 24 mpg combined. Opting for the available all-wheel drive (AWD) system slightly impacts fuel economy, resulting in an EPA-estimated 20 mpg city, 28 mpg highway, and 23 mpg combined.
Towing Capacity and Fuel Tank
Specification | FWD | AWD |
---|---|---|
Towing Capacity (with trailer brakes) | 3,000 lbs. | 3,000 lbs. |
Towing Capacity (without trailer brakes) | 1,650 lbs. | 1,650 lbs. |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 17.7 gallons | 17.7 gallons |

Technology and Connectivity
The 2024 Hyundai Santa Fe Calligraphy is packed with cutting-edge technology and connectivity features that enhance the driving experience. One of the standout features is the 12.3-inch digital instrument cluster seamlessly integrated with a 12.3-inch infotainment setup, creating a panoramic digital experience for the driver.
Hyundai's intuitive infotainment system comes standard, offering w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to connectivity for seamless smartphone integration. The Santa Fe also introduces a "Phone as key" system, with the new digital key providing easier access and remote-control functions.
Driver Assistance and Safety Technology
The Calligraphy trim boasts an impressive array of driver assistance and safety features, including:
- Forward-facing camera as part of the surround-view parking system
- Driver attention warning system that monitors driver inputs and issues alerts when necessary
- Forward attention warning using an infrared camera to track the driver's gaze
- Highway Driving Assist (HDA) with two levels of collaborative support for speed and steering adjustments on highways
- HDA 2 system (Calligraphy exclusive) capable of automatically changing lanes under certain conditions
Notably, the 2024 Santa Fe is the first Hyundai to feature a driver monitoring system with an infrared driver-facing camera to track the driver's gaze, ensuring attentive driving.

Warranty and Maintenance
Hyundai is known for offering one of the best warranty packages in the industry, and the 2024 Santa Fe Calligraphy is no exception. Here's what you can expect:
- 5-year/60,000-mile New Vehicle Limited Warranty
- 10-year/100,000-mile Powertrain Limited Warranty
- 7-year/unlimited miles Anti-perforation Warranty
- 5-year/unlimited miles 24/7 Roadside Assistance
- 3-year/36,000-mile Complimentary Maintenance program, including oil and oil filter changes, and tire rotations at normal factory scheduled intervals
This comprehensive warranty package provides peace of mind and helps to protect your investment in the long run.
